Emart Supermarket presents prizes to contest winners

MIRI: Emart Supermarket at Tudan here on Saturday presented prizes to winners of the Follow Me Lucky Dip and Boh Tea Garden contests winners.

In the Follow Me contest, Chiam Chung Wei emerged the first prize winner. He received a cash voucher from the supermarket worth RM1,000.

Three lucky shoppers who will also be doing their shopping spree are Houng Yew Kwong, Thung Chai Hock and Stephen Liew. Each won a cash voucher worth RM500.

In addition, three third prize winners also received cash vouchers worth RM250 each. They were Jacky Ho, Boon Soon Hin and Toh Kah Hwa. Nine shoppers won the fourth prize of a RM100 cash voucher. They were Ho Ling Eng, Sia Chui Yok, Cheah Jenn Loong, Chia Guan Chin, Doreen Bilong, Hanim Jaraee, Kong Ting Ting, Dayangku Norshidawak and Rose Bubot.

Twenty eight other shoppers each won the consolation prize of a RM50 cash voucher.

In the Boh Tea Garden Contest, Mohd Zarir Mohd Salleh won the grand prize of a RM800 cash voucher.

Matthias Teo Zi Chuan took the first prize of a RM500 cash voucher while Doris Chong received the second prize of a RM300 cash voucher while Who Chen Huang won the third prize of a RM150 cash voucher.

Five shoppers each won the consolation prize of a Boh hamper. They were Simon Huong, Ngieng Sik Hung, Wong King Hua, Kwan Wei Ken and Hwong Mee Min.

The Follow Me Lucky Dip contest started from Feb 7 until March 30 where shoppers who purchased Follow Me product worth RM25 and above were entitled to participate.

The Boh Tea Garden contest was held from March 27 to April 5 and shoppers who purchased Boh products worth RM20 and above were entitled to join the contest. Both contests were organised by Emart Supermarket.
